Output 64f9486203117566f97d5b83c30eb47f0433d7aadd18267bde596c52a5d5039c: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 720ba4184b48c6a8d8e54f254a4830987c8f9122 OP_EQUAL
address
3C62uF3eTjQeD1SQcuVijY1yNHNWAgQqmU
transaction
64f9486203117566f97d5b83c30eb47f0433d7aadd18267bde596c52a5d5039c
confirmations
459390
spent
true